Region Advisor Biography
Nadine Mbikina, DTM
Member Since: 2010Home Region: 11
Home District: 94
Supporting Districts: 74, 79, 94, 104, 114, 129, 130
Toastmasters offices held and terms of service (international, region and District level):
- 2024-2025 Immediate Past District Director
- 2023-2024 District Director
- 2022-2023 District Program Quality Director
- 2021-2022 District Club Growth Director
Toastmasters honors and recognition:
- 2023-2024 Smedley Distinguished District Director
- 2022-2023 District Program Quality Award
- 2021-2022 Excellence in Club Growth Award

What is your experience with coaching individuals and/or teams?
I am truly passionate about mentoring and coaching. I practice it through my YouTube channel Mentorattitude, but also professionally, where I manage an office of nearly 100 staff members as operations officer . I have organized and facilitated several team-building activities, both for my office in Conakry and for other WHO offices. As a senior Manager at the World Health Organization, I mentor many staff members ( WHO mentorship programme) and have coached diverse teams in different contexts. My experience with Toastmasters has also strengthened these skills. Our district spans several countries across West and Central Africa, where I have led multicultural teams, adapted to different working styles, and guided them toward ambitious goals. I have been fortunate to work with strong, motivated teams that I have inspired and supported to consistently meet and often exceed their objectives.
